Ingredients
- 4 salmon fillets (6 oz each) salmon
- 2 lemons, zested and juiced lemon
- 1/4 cup fresh dill, chopped dill
- 1 tbsp extra virgin olive oil olive oil
- 1 cup uncooked wild rice wild rice
- 3 cups water water
- 1 tsp salt salt
Instructions
- Step 1: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). In a bowl, whisk together lemon juice, lemon zest, dill, olive oil, salt, and 1 tbsp water.
- Step 2: Place salmon fillets on a baking sheet, brush with half the glaze, and bake for 15-18 minutes until flaky.
- Step 3: Cook wild rice according to package instructions, using 3 cups water and 1 tsp salt. Serve salmon over rice with remaining glaze drizzled on top.

How do I store leftover Best Ever Lemon-Dill Salmon?
Cool to room temperature within 2 hours, then store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Reheat covered in a 350°F oven for 10-12 minutes, or microwave at 70% power in 60-second bursts to keep fresh dill, chopped dill from drying out.
